-- ## Parking Problems
--
-- One big issue in DCS is that not all aircraft can be spawned on every airport or airbase. In particular, bigger aircraft might not have a valid parking spot at smaller airports and
-- airstripes. This can lead to multiple problems in DCS.
--
-- * Landing: When an aircraft tries to land at an airport where it does not have a valid parking spot, it is immidiately despawned the moment its wheels touch the runway, i.e.
-- when a landing event is triggered. This leads to the loss of the RAT aircraft. On possible way to circumvent the this problem is to let another RAT aircraft spawn at landing
-- and not when it shuts down its engines. See the @{RAT.RespawnAfterLanding}() function.
-- * Spawning: When a big aircraft is dynamically spawned on a small airbase a few things can go wrong. For example, it could be spawned at a parking spot with a shelter.
-- Or it could be damaged by a scenery object when it is taxiing out to the runway, or it could overlap with other aircraft on parking spots near by.
--
-- You can check yourself if an aircraft has a valid parking spot at an airbase by dragging its group on the airport in the mission editor and set it to start from ramp.
-- If it stays at the airport, it has a valid parking spot, if it jumps to another airport, it does not have a valid parking spot on that airbase.
--
-- ### Setting the Terminal Type
-- Each parking spot has a specific type depending on its size or if a helicopter spot or a shelter etc. The classification is not perfect but it is the best we have.
-- If you encounter problems described above, you can request a specific terminal type for the RAT aircraft. This can be done by the @{#RAT.SetTerminalType}(*terminaltype*)
-- function. The parameter *terminaltype* can be set as follows
--
-- * AIRBASE.TerminalType.HelicopterOnly: Special spots for Helicopers.
-- * AIRBASE.TerminalType.Shelter: Hardened Air Shelter. Currently only on Caucaus map.
-- * AIRBASE.TerminalType.OpenMed: Open/Shelter air airplane only.
-- * AIRBASE.TerminalType.OpenBig: Open air spawn points. Generally larger but does not guarantee large aircraft are capable of spawning there.
-- * AIRBASE.TerminalType.OpenMedOrBig: Combines OpenMed and OpenBig spots.
-- * AIRBASE.TerminalType.HelicopterUnsable: Combines HelicopterOnly, OpenMed and OpenBig.
-- * AIRBASE.TerminalType.FighterAircraft: Combines Shelter, OpenMed and OpenBig spots. So effectively all spots usable by fixed wing aircraft.
--
-- So for example
-- c17=RAT:New("C-17")
-- c17:SetTerminalType(AIRBASE.TerminalType.OpenBig)
-- c17:Spawn(5)
--
-- This would randomly spawn five C-17s but only on airports which have big open air parking spots. Note that also only destination airports are allowed
-- which do have this type of parking spot. This should ensure that the aircraft is able to land at the destination without beeing despawned immidiately.
--
-- Also, the aircraft are spawned only on the requested parking spot types and not on any other type. If no parking spot of this type is availabe at the
-- moment of spawning, the group is automatically spawned in air above the selected airport.
